Sony: feeling good" about the progress of Blu-ray.

The long-term success of PS3 rests largely on take-up of Blu-ray as the next generation DVD platform. PlayStation 3 comes with a Blu-ray drive, which offers comparative value against specific players currently on the market. Blu-ray is up against HD-DVD for dominance of this emerging market.

In an earnings conference call yesterday Rob Wiesenthal, chief financial officer of Sony's U.S. operations said "We are feeling really good about Blu-ray right now, but it is early days."
